Himitsu: The Revelation (also known as Himitsu: Top Secret ) is a 2008 psychological sci-fi mystery anime that explores a future where a specialized police unit can view the memories of deceased people.

A method known as "MRI" allows investigators to extract and scan memories from a human brain for up to 48 hours after death.

While this technology is a powerful tool for solving complex crimes, it raises severe ethical dilemmas regarding privacy and the psychological toll on the investigators who must witness a victim's most intimate—and often horrific—final moments.
